CNet is reporting: “Napster may or may not be good for CD sales, but online music sites can thank the
popular file-swapping service for a substantial surge in revenues last month …

   Advertising spending at online music sites jumped dramatically in
   the week after a federal judge clamped down on the music
   company, according to AdRelevance, a division of online traffic
   measurement company Media Metrix.”
